About the Book.

A sweeping, tenderhearted love story, Beyond That, the Sea by Laura Spence-Ash tells the story of two families living through World War II on opposite sides of the Atlantic Ocean, and the shy, irresistible young woman who will call them both her own.

About the Author.

Laura Spence-Ash’s debut novel, Beyond That, The Sea, was published by Celadon Books in March 2023. Her short fiction has appeared in One Story, New England Review, Crazyhorse and elsewhere. She has received fellowships and support from MacDowell, the Virginia Center for Creative Arts, the Kimmel Harding Nelson Center, and Sewanee Writers’ Conference. She earned her MFA in Fiction from Rutgers-Newark where she received the Presidential Fellowship. Photo Credit: Beowulf Sheehan

About the Moderator. 

Patrick Ryan is the author of the novel Buckeye (forthcoming from Random House in the summer of 2025). His short story collection, The Dream Life of Astronauts, was named one of the Best Books of the Year by the St. Louis Times-Dispatch, LitHub, Refinery 29, and Electric Literature, and was longlisted for The Story Prize. His debut collection of linked short stories, Send Me, was selected for Barnes & Noble’s Discover New Writers program. His writing has appeared in The Best American Short Stories, the anthology Tales of Two Cities, and elsewhere. Patrick is a recipient of writing fellowships from MacDowell, the National Endowment for the Arts, and the Liguria Study Center. He is also the author of three novels for young adults. The former associate editor of Granta and current editor-in-chief of One Story, he lives in New York City.
